In the detritus food chain, primary consumers of the dead matter or detritus are detritivores. The chain starts with the detritivores. The organisms that consume the dead and decayed matter are called detritivores. 

The source of the energy in this food chain is decayed matter. The energy is then transferred from one organism to the other and the flow is carried on in this way to make a chain of the energy derived from the detritus.

Examples of Detritus Food Chain

[Click Here for Previous Year Questions]

Few examples of the detritus food chain are specified below:

  • A dead plant is consumed by microbes (detritivores) present in the soil before it gets decomposed. The bacteria present in the soil are consumed by the earthworms which are consumed by rats and rats are consumed by snakes and snakes by predators like vultures or eagles. 
  • The dead material or the fecal material excreted by the detritivores is carried away by the water currents in an aquatic ecosystem. The material later settles on the bottom of the water bodies and continues its process of energy transfer. 
  • Whereas, in the land ecosystem, the dead and decayed matter or even the fecal matter remains on the surface of the land. The dead matter is decomposed partially there and the rest of the process is taken by the organisms whilst transferring the energy in them.

Ques. What is a food chain, explain with an example? What are its types? (3 Marks)

Ans. A food chain describes how energy and nutrients move through an ecosystem. At the basic level, there are plants that produce the energy, then it moves up to higher-level organisms like herbivores. After that when carnivores eat the herbivores, energy is transferred from one to the other. A food chain always starts with the producer and ends with an apex predator. 

Example of the food chain: grass - insects - lizard - snake.

The food chain is broadly divided into two parts: (i) the detritus food chain and (ii) the grazing food chain.
